Cycling Accidents

It is amazing how many motorists still think cyclists are nothing but a nuisance and the road belongs to them alone. Cycling is a great way to get around the city and see the country, but there is no doubt that it can be dangerous. Unlike motorists who are encased in a steel box a cyclist is virtually unprotected and when it comes to car and cycle crashes it is nearly always the cyclist who comes off worst.

As more and more people are getting into the pleasures of cycling many states are also introducing more cycling lanes to make cycling safer. This is a positive move, but cyclists still need to be aware that many motorists simply ignore this, or still don’t look when turning.

The most common causes of cyclist and motor vehicle accidents occur when:

  • Motorists are not paying attention – “I just didn’t the cyclist”
  • Turning in front of a cyclist while pulling into traffic
  • Motorists not looking for bikes when pulling out from a stop sign
  • Motorists failing to yield for cyclists
  • Motorists under the influence of alcohol or drugs

While motorists should understand the laws of sharing the road with cyclists all too often they forget. This makes it doubly important for cyclists to understand and obey the rules and to always be vigilant for possible problems on the road.

If you are a parent make sure your children take proper training lessons in cycle safety. Over 1 million children a year are severely injured in cycling accidents and half of all fatalities from cycling are children under 16 years of age.

Motorists are not the only causes of cycling accidents either. Sometimes injuries can occur if the bicycle itself is defective. It is worth paying a little more for a product you can rely on to be safe than to take the risk of suffering personal injury.
